TAXI COMPANIES

Taxi stands are clearly marked and the starting fare is 1.50 KM. All vehicles use a taxi meter and the driver will issue a receipt upon request.

The regular rate per kilometer is 1 KM, and it is possible to negotiate a rate with the driver in advance for distances longer than 25 kilometers.

All legitimate taxis are required to have a “TAXI” sign on top and license plates with “TA” on them. Taxi fares can only be paid in cash and 1 KM is charged for each piece of baggage.

Taxi fares can vary, depending on traffic, but they should not be much higher than the following:

.               Airport – Baščaršija: 17-20 KM

.               Airport – Ilidža: 6-8 KM

.               Sarajevo Train/Bus Station – Baščaršija: 6-8 KM

.               East Sarajevo Bus Station – Baščaršija: 17-20 KM

.               Sarajevo – Igman/Bjelašnica: cca 60 KM

.               Sarajevo – Jahorina: cca 60 KM

.               Baščaršija – Trebević: 14-16 KM

 

APPROXIMATE TRAVEL TIME (AT NORMAL TRAFFIC):

From Sarajevo International airport to Hotel Holiday: 21 min by car From Hotel Holiday to Baščaršija (old city center): 8 min by car

 

PUBLIC TRANSPORT
Sarajevo is well connected with different means of public transporation. Tram and trolleybus tickets are available at kiosks (single fare 1.60 KM) or in a tram/trolleybus (single fare 1.80 M). A bus line runs between the International Sarajevo airport and Baščaršija and coincides with flight timetables. You must have your tickets “punched” upon entering the vehicle. There are also multi-ride tickets available for the trams, which are ideal if you plan on using public transport for getting around town.
